Why the TI-84 Series Rules the Classroom
The TI-84 Plus is more than just a calculator; it is a handheld mathematical computer. Approved for major exams like the PSAT, SAT, and ACT, it allows students to visualize complex functions, solve definite integrals, and perform advanced statistical operations including mean, median, and variance (IdeaExchange@UAkron, 2025).
Beyond simple arithmetic, these devices are central to STEAM education, helping students develop computational thinking skills through pattern generalization and algorithmic problem-solving (AIP Publishing, 2026).
1. TI-84 Plus CE Python Edition (Top Pick)
The TI-84 Plus CE is the modern evolution of the classic TI-84. It features a high-resolution, full-color backlit display and a rechargeable battery.
- Key Feature: Includes a built-in Python programming environment, allowing students to learn coding alongside math.
- Best For: Students who want a future-proof device that lasts from 9th grade through university.
2. TI-84 Plus CE (Standard Color)
This is the slim, lightweight version of the original TI-84 Plus. It is 30% thinner and significantly lighter than older models.
- Key Feature: The “MathPrint” functionality displays expressions, symbols, and fractions exactly as they appear in textbooks.
- Best For: Standard high school curriculum and standardized testing.
3. TI-84 Plus (The Original Workhorse)
The classic “brick” model. While it lacks a color screen and uses AAA batteries, it is virtually indestructible and highly reliable.
- Key Feature: Familiar interface used by almost every math teacher in the US.
- Best For: Students on a budget or those who prefer the tactile feel of a traditional calculator.

5. TI-Nspire CX II CAS
If you need more power than a TI-84, the TI-Nspire series is the “pro” version.
- Key Feature: CAS (Computer Algebra System) allows the device to solve equations symbolically (e.g., solving for x in terms of y).
- Warning: Because of the CAS feature, it is prohibited on the ACT, though allowed on the SAT.
6. Casio FX-9750GIII (Best Value)
A direct competitor to the TI-84 Plus, often available at half the price.
- Key Feature: Capable of graphing, unit conversion, and Python programming.
- Best For: Students looking for TI-84 features without the premium price tag.
7. Casio FX-CG50 PRIZM
Casioโs answer to the TI-84 Plus CE. It offers a stunning color display and 3D graphing capabilities.
- Key Feature: “Picture Plot” technology allows you to graph over real-life images to model real-world math.
8. HP Prime Graphing Calculator
A high-performance calculator with a touchscreen interface.
- Key Feature: Pinch-to-zoom and a sleek, smartphone-like experience.
- Best For: Engineering students who need rapid calculation speeds.
9. TI-83 Plus (The Legacy Choice)
The predecessor to the TI-84. Most programs written for the TI-84 will still run on an 83 Plus.
- Best For: Middle schoolers or as a secondary “backup” calculator for basic graphing needs.
10. NumWorks Graphing Calculator
A newcomer with a highly intuitive, user-friendly interface designed for the modern era.
- Key Feature: Open-source software and a very simple navigation menu.
Comparison Table: At a Glance
| Model | Screen Type | Programming | Exam Approval | Power Source |
|---|---|---|---|---|
| TI-84 Plus CE | Color | Python/Basic | SAT, ACT, AP | Rechargeable |
| TI-84 Plus | B&W | Basic | SAT, ACT, AP | 4 AAA Batteries |
| Casio FX-9750GIII | B&W | Python/Basic | SAT, ACT, AP | 4 AAA Batteries |
| TI-Nspire CX II CAS | Color | Python/Lua | SAT, AP (No ACT) | Rechargeable |
